Gentoo Linux Security Advisory                           GLSA 202402-04
-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-
                                           https://security.gentoo.org/
-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-

 Severity: High
    Title: GNAT Ada Suite: Remote Code Execution
     Date: February 03, 2024
     Bugs: #787440
       ID: 202402-04

-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-

Synopsis
========

A vulnerability has been discovered in GNAT Ada Suite which can lead to
remote code execution.

Background
==========

The GNAT Ada Suite is an Ada development environment.

Affected packages
=================

Package                 Vulnerable    Unaffected
----------------------  ------------  ------------
dev-ada/gnat-suite-bin  < 2019-r2     Vulnerable!

Description
===========

A vulnerability has been discovered in GNAT Ada Suite. Please review the
CVE identifier referenced below for details.

Impact
======

Please review the referenced CVE identifiers for details.

Workaround
==========

There is no known workaround at this time.

Resolution
==========

Gentoo has discontinued support for GNAT Ada Suite. We recommend that
users unmerge it:

  # emerge --ask --depclean "dev-ada/gnat-suite-bin"
